Not long before her father, Aldrich Lockwood, was murdered, an 18-year old Patricia was abducted by two people and taken to a place she dubbed the Hut of Horrors, where she was repeatedly abused before escaping. The FBI contacts Win when two items connected to the Lockwood family an original Johannes Vermeer painting that was stolen 20 years ago and a suitcase bearing Wins initials are found in the apartment.
